An example of implementing QuickReturn on a RecyclerView using a StaggeredGridLayoutManager to display CardViews inside a SwipeRefreshLayout.

This is an example project that shows one approach (probably not the best one!) of implementing the QuickReturn pattern with a RecyclerView that uses the StaggeredGridLayoutManager. For grins, the whole thing also supports Pull-to-Refresh using a SwipeRefreshLayout. By the way, the cells within the layout are CardViews, and use the card_view:cardUseCompatPadding="true" attribute to display properly on Lollipop.

The idea is that the QR view should not cover the top items in the RV. This is now accomplished with a custom (but trivial) ItemDecoration. As a result, the adapter and layoutmanager are plain vanilla. I'm sure there's a better way, so if you find it, please explain it to me! :-)

##Changes

  1. (2015-1-2) Added TargetedSwipeRefreshLayout (TSRL) to permit multiple views within the SwipeRefreshLayout.
  2. (2015-1-2) Removed topview detection from onScrollListener (no longer needed with TSRL).
  3. (2014-11-14) Modified the spacing hack to use an ItemDecorator (cleaner approach).

##TODO

  1. (2014-11-14) It's been suggested that I look into using ItemDecoration instead of adjusting cell margins during onBind.
  2. (2015-03-18) Fixed using recyclerview-v7 R22 Need to address issue of inserting items at top of grid.
